Woodstock GA 30189: Complete Zip Code Real Estate Guide

The 30189 zip code covers the southern portion of Woodstock, Georgia, extending toward the Cobb County border. While less well-known than 30188, the 30189 zip code offers strong value, excellent schools, and easy access to both Woodstock's amenities and the I-575/I-75 corridor.

30189 at a Glance

Metric3018930188
Average Home Value$446,495$455,826
Median List Price~$480,000$526,403
Price Per Square Foot$195-$225$220-$250
Days on Market42-55 days37-45 days
Typical Lot Size0.25-0.75 acres0.15-0.35 acres

What's Inside 30189

Ridgewalk / Bells Ferry Road Corridor — Established subdivisions built primarily in the 1990s and early 2000s. Home prices range from $340,000 to $480,000 for 3-4 bedroom single-family homes on 0.25-0.5 acre lots.

Woodstock South / Wooten Lake Road Area — Convenient for buyers who work in Kennesaw or along the I-75 corridor. Homes range from $320,000 to $500,000 with larger lots.

Newer Communities (2015-2024) — Master-planned communities with pools, tennis courts, and walking trails. Homes typically range from $420,000 to $600,000.

Townhome Communities — Near the I-575 interchange, offering $300,000-$380,000 price points with strong rental demand.

Schools Serving 30189

School LevelPrimary Schools
ElementaryCarmel, Johnston, Bascomb
MiddleWoodstock Middle, E.T. Booth Middle
High SchoolSequoyah High School, Woodstock High School

Sequoyah High School is highly regarded for its STEM programs and college placement rates.

30189 vs. 30188: Key Differences

Factor3018830189
Walkability to DowntownHighLow
Lot SizesSmallerLarger
Price Per Square FootHigherLower
New Construction AvailabilityLimitedMore available
I-75 AccessLongerFaster

Why Buyers Choose 30189

Better value per square foot (10-15% more home for the same budget), larger lots, Sequoyah High School's STEM programs, faster I-75 access for Kennesaw/Marietta commuters, and strong investment potential in townhome communities.
